How to Choose the Best Health Insurance Plan for Your Family

admin January 17, 2026
How to Choose the Best Health Insurance Plan for Your Family

Learn how to choose the best health insurance plan for your family. Compare coverage, costs, networks, benefits, and tips to protect your family’s health and budget. Choosing the right health insurance plan for your family can feel overwhelming—but it doesn’t have to be. With the right approach, you can find a plan that balances coverage, cost, and peace of mind. Let’s break it down step by step in simple, practical terms so you can make a confident decision.


1. Understand Your Family’s Healthcare Needs

Start by looking at your family’s current and expected medical needs.

  • How often do family members visit the doctor?
  • Do you have young children who need frequent checkups and vaccinations?
  • Are there any chronic conditions or ongoing treatments?
  • Do you expect major events like pregnancy or surgery?

👉 If your family uses healthcare often, a plan with higher premiums but lower out-of-pocket costs may save you money overall.


2. Learn the Basic Cost Components

A good plan isn’t just about the monthly price. You need to understand the full cost picture:

  • Premium: Monthly amount you pay to keep coverage active
  • Deductible: What you pay before insurance starts covering expenses
  • Copay: Fixed fee for doctor visits or prescriptions
  • Coinsurance: Percentage you pay after meeting the deductible
  • Out-of-Pocket Maximum: The most you’ll pay in a year

💡 Tip: A low premium plan may cost more later if deductibles and copays are high.


3. Choose the Right Type of Health Insurance Plan

Different plan structures offer different levels of flexibility and cost.

  • HMO (Health Maintenance Organization):
    Lower cost, limited network, referrals required
  • PPO (Preferred Provider Organization):
    Higher cost, more freedom to see specialists
  • EPO (Exclusive Provider Organization):
    No referrals, but must stay in-network
  • POS (Point of Service):
    Mix of HMO and PPO features

👉 Families who value flexibility usually prefer PPO plans, while budget-conscious families often choose HMO plans.


4. Check the Doctor and Hospital Network

Always confirm that your preferred:

  • Family doctor
  • Pediatrician
  • Specialists
  • Nearby hospitals

are in-network. Out-of-network care can be very expensive or not covered at all.


5. Review Coverage for Children and Maternity Care

For families, this step is crucial. Make sure the plan includes:

  • Pediatric care and vaccinations
  • Maternity and newborn care
  • Emergency services
  • Mental health support
  • Prescription drug coverage

These benefits can make a big difference in both care quality and cost.

6. Compare Prescription Drug Coverage

If any family member takes regular medication:

  • Check whether those drugs are covered
  • See if there are generic alternatives
  • Review copay amounts for prescriptions

A plan with poor drug coverage can quietly become very expensive.


7. Consider Future Family Needs

Don’t just think about today—think ahead:

  • Planning to expand your family?
  • Children approaching school age?
  • Aging parents joining your household?

Choosing a plan that can adapt to future needs saves you from switching policies too often.


8. Look Beyond the Cheapest Option

It’s tempting to choose the lowest-priced plan, but that can backfire.

Ask yourself:

  • What will this plan cost in a medical emergency?
  • Can we afford the deductible if something serious happens?
  • Does it offer peace of mind?

The best plan is one that protects your family financially and medically.


9. Check Enrollment Periods and Eligibility

Most plans can only be selected during open enrollment, unless you have a qualifying life event such as:

  • Marriage
  • Birth of a child
  • Job change

Missing deadlines can limit your options.


10. Read the Policy Details Carefully

Before finalizing:

  • Review exclusions and limitations
  • Understand claim procedures
  • Check waiting periods

If something isn’t clear, ask questions—never assume.


Final Thoughts

Choosing the best health insurance plan for your family isn’t about finding the perfect policy—it’s about finding the right balance. By understanding your family’s needs, comparing costs carefully, and reviewing coverage details, you can select a plan that keeps your loved ones protected without breaking your budget.

A well-chosen health insurance plan isn’t just an expense—it’s an investment in your family’s future health and security.
